Java developer
JSR Tech Consulting
New Jersey, United States Full Time Technology Jobs United States
Job Description
Java developer role at JSR Tech Consulting in Newark, NJ (Hybrid). Payrate: $65-$75 per hour.
Responsibilities
- Lead and execute migration from legacy Java applications to modern Java frameworks.
- Develop, maintain, and optimize enterprise-scale applications across old and new Java frameworks (EJB, SpringBoot, etc).
- Collaborate with cross-functional teams to design, develop, and deploy high-quality software solutions.
- Integrate AI-assisted development tools, focusing on using Claude.
- Provide technical leadership and mentoring to junior developers.
- Ensure code quality, security, and performance across systems.
Required Qualifications
- 15+ years of professional Java development experience.
- Proficiency in old and modern Java frameworks, old web servers (e.g., Websphere) and new infrastructure (AWS ECS or Kubernetes).
- Hands‑on experience in Java modernization/migration projects.
- Expertise converting legacy Java codebases to updated architectures.
- Experience consuming and developing APIs; implementing SOA patterns; and working with web service technologies such as APIs, REST, JSON, SOAP, XML, JDBC, MySQL.
- Knowledge of unit, integration, and end‑user testing concepts and tooling (functional & non‑functional).
- Experience with automated testing.
- Software security skills including secure coding, web application security, DevSecOps; solid grasp of authentication, authorization, encryption, digital signatures, JWT, SSL, web service proxies, firewalls, SAML 2.0, OpenID Connect, OAuth 2.0.
- DevOps tools & practices: Branching with GitHub or Bitbucket; CI/CD with Jenkins or GitHub Actions.
- Familiarity with SDLC monitoring and logging techniques.
- Familiarity with Claude AI coding capabilities.
- Strong problem‑solving, debugging, and optimization skills.
- Ability to work independently and in teams with minimal supervision.
- Must be located in New York or New Jersey.
Preferred Qualifications
- Experience in the insurance industry.
- Japanese language proficiency is a plus (not a must).
- Portfolio or GitHub repositories showcasing similar Java migration projects.
- Live coding in interview sessions to demonstrate technical skills.
Additional Information
Seniority level: Mid‑Senior level
Employment type: Other
Job function: Information Technology
Industries: IT Services and IT Consulting
Referrals increase your chances of interviewing at JSR Tech Consulting by 2x.
#J-18808-Ljbffr
Posted April 12, 2026